Output fb683303b357f9e7ce4fe7c63b40e1b27eb6b0faa128b9f5ad437189f4e184c0:0

value
883391569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3434d5ac68b10ad7e88b8d6868f83aa288c3bd8e OP_EQUAL
address
36T4MY23MWfFuWxAtaHyk6UqTZTnfQjna1
transaction
fb683303b357f9e7ce4fe7c63b40e1b27eb6b0faa128b9f5ad437189f4e184c0
spent
true